The time at which all 4 mobile phones will ring together is 10 a.m.
It is given that there are 4 mobile phones in a house at 5 am. All the 4 mobile phones will ring together
First one rings every 15 minutes
Second one rings every 20 minutes
Third one rings every 25 minutes
4th one rings every 30 minutes.
From the given data we understand that we need to find the exact time after which all 4 mobiles will ring together, even though they have different ringing intervals.
The only way we can determine that is by taking an LCM( lowest common multiple) of the 4 ringing intervals.
The ringing intervals are 15, 20, 25 and 30
Finding L.C.M of 15, 20, 25 and 30:
List all prime factors for each number
Prime factors of 15 = 3 X 5
Prime factors of 20 = 2 X 2 X 5
Prime factors of 25 = 5 X 5
Prime factors of 30 = 2 X 3 X 5
For each prime factor, find where it occurs most often as a factor and write it that many times in a new list.
The new superset list is
2, 2, 3, 5, 5
Multiply these factors together to find the LCM.
Hence all the 4 phones will ring together 300 mins after 5a.m.
300 minutes = 5 hours
So 5 a.m + 5 hours = 10 a.m
Thus, the time at which all 4 mobile phones will ring together is 10a.m
